GENERAL SAFETY INFORMATION

(FOR 12 VDC UNITS ONLY)

1.  General connection information to a 12 VDC battery:

a.

  Connect POSITIVE or PLUS(+) lead from the pump to battery first. 

POSITIVE lead of pump is red.

b.  Connect NEGATIVE or MINUS(-) lead last. NEGATIVE lead of pump 

is black.

c.  When  DISCONNECTING  –  Disconnect  NEGATIVE  (-)  lead  first, 

then disconnect the POSITIVE (+) lead from the battery.

2. 

Specific connection information

:

a.  If pump is installed in car or truck and the installed car or truck 

battery is being used:

(1)  Connect POSITIVE or PLUS (+) lead from the pump to battery 

first. POSITIVE lead of pump is red.

(2)  Then connect NEGATIVE or MINUS (-) lead to a ground away 

from the battery, such as the metal of the car. Always connect 

NEGATIVE (-) last. NEGATIVE lead of pump is black.

(3)  When DISCONNECTING – Disconnect the NEGATIVE (-) lead 

from the grounded location, then disconnect the POSITIVE (+) 

lead from the battery.

b.  Pump is installed in recreational vehicle (RV), boat, motor home, etc.

(1)  Follow general connection information.

(2)  If possible, connect NEGATIVE (-) lead of the pump to negative 

wiring terminal strip or other negative common point of the 

battery (away from the battery) if so equipped.

3.  When attaching pump leads to battery terminals, be sure that the area 

(bilge of a boat, for instance) is adequately ventilated to prevent an 

explosion or fire from explosive or flammable vapors that may be present.

Batteries emit hydrogen gas which is explosive. Avoid smoking, sparks 

or open flame anywhere in the vicinity of the battery.
Explosion from battery can cause blindness. Shield eyes when working 

near 

any battery.

Batteries  contain  sulfuric  acid.  In  case  of  contact  with  eyes,  skin  or 

clothing, 

flush  immediately  with  large  amount  of  water,  get  medical 

attention.

4.  When using leads longer than those supplied, be sure the wire is 

adequately sized.

Do not add acid or electrolyte to battery being used – add only water. 

Consult the battery manufacturers for any additional safety instructions.

INSTALLATION (FOR 12 VDC UNITS ONLY)

WIRING & ROTATION

Connect black wire to NEGATIVE (-) terminal of battery. The orange wire with 

the fuse holder should run to an overload protected switch or circuit breaker, 

with a wire from switch or breaker to POSITIVE (+) terminal of battery. Electrical 

circuit must be independent of all other accessories. To prolong motor life, 

install pump so normal motor rotation is clockwise (See Figure 1). Use proper 

wire size as determined by Wire Table (See Figure 1). The proper fuse has 

been included in the fuse holder. Should this fuse blow, replace with the same 

size fuse after determining reason for blown fuse. 

NOTE:

 No warranty consideration will be given to pumps that are returned 

without the properly sized fuse and fuse holder supplied with the pump.

DESCRIPTION

This compact utility pump is designed for a wide range of dewatering and liquid transfer applications including marine and aquaculture. Handles liquids from 40° F

to 180° F (4º to 82º C). This is a manual unit, no controls are supplied. For use with nonflammable, non-abrasive liquids compatible with pump component ma

-

terials.

These pumps self-prime (to 4-1/2 ft. lift with pump filled) and can be used as a bilge pump for small boats or a water system pump in campers and trailers. The 

pump can be mounted up to a 45° angle or on a thru-hull fitting and seacock for applications requiring water aboard to be pumped overboard.
